← 返回信息流
AI 资讯Hacker News·4 小时前

AMD 为 Linux 准备全面开源 HDMI 2.1 支持

原标题:AMD Readies Full Open-Source HDMI 2.1 Support for Linux

速览

AMD 正在推进 Linux 内核中 HDMI 2.1 协议的全面开源支持。此举旨在完善 Linux 图形栈对新一代显示标准的兼容性。这将提升 Linux 用户在高分辨率和高刷新率显示设备上的使用体验。

AI 深度解读

AMD 准备为 Linux 提供完整的开源 HDMI 2.1 支持

背景

长期以来,AMD 一直在努力推动 HDMI Forum(HDMI 标准的管理机构)批准在 Linux 系统上实现开源的 HDMI 2.1 支持,但此前遭遇了强烈的拒绝。HDMI Forum 一直要求厂商遵守其严格的授权和公平使用条款,这导致开源社区在实现最新 HDMI 标准时面临法律和技术上的双重障碍。

与此同时,Valve 作为 Steam Deck 和 SteamOS 的核心推动者,一直依赖 AMD 的图形硬件。去年年底,据报道 Valve 曾试图说服 HDMI Forum 领导层批准 AMD 将这一实现引入开源 Linux 堆栈的努力。然而,在那之后,外界并未收到相关进展的更新。直到最近,情况似乎发生了转变。

核心内容

根据 Phoronix 的报道,AMD Linux 开发者暗示,经过数年的工作,公司正在为 AMDGPU 驱动程序准备完整的 HDMI 2.1 支持,这将带来一个完全开源的实现方案。

技术突破:Fixed Rate Link (FRL)

AMD 已提交了第一组 Linux 内核补丁,重点聚焦于 HDMI 2.1 标准独有的 Fixed Rate Link (FRL,固定速率链路) 功能。

  • 带宽提升:FRL 功能通过端口提供更高的带宽。
  • 分辨率支持:这使得运行基于 Linux 操作系统的 AMD GPU 能够有效支持 4K 分辨率下 120 Hz 以及 5K 分辨率下 240 Hz 的输出。
  • 必要性:由于这些高分辨率和高刷新率需要极高的数据带宽,AMDGPU 开源显卡驱动程序必须从当前支持的 HDMI 2.0 升级到更新的 HDMI 2.1 标准。

Valve 的关键角色与谈判进展

Valve 在这一过程中发挥了重要作用。由于 SteamOS 运行在基于 AMD RDNA 3 GPU 的 Steam Machine 上,Valve 利用其硬件经验和影响力,与 HDMI Forum 领导层进行了重大谈判,旨在为开源实现争取批准。

历史回顾与阻力

  • AMD 的前期投入:AMD 此前已投入工程资源,耗时数月内部开发必要代码,并于 2024 年将其公开。
  • HDMI Forum 的强烈反对:此前,HDMI Forum 强烈回应称,在不违反其公平使用要求的情况下,实现开源版本是不可能的。
  • 现状转变:Valve 的介入和谈判似乎取得了成效,使得 AMD 能够克服之前的障碍,正式提交内核补丁。

关键要点

  • 开源 HDMI 2.1 实现取得突破:AMD 已提交 Linux 内核补丁,标志着完全开源的 HDMI 2.1 支持即将落地。
  • 核心技术支持高刷新率:通过引入 HDMI 2.1 特有的 FRL 功能,Linux 上的 AMD GPU 将支持 4K@120Hz 和 5K@240Hz 的高带宽显示输出。
  • Valve 的游说成功:Valve 凭借其 SteamOS 生态和 AMD 硬件的依赖关系,成功与 HDMI Forum 进行谈判,打破了此前开源实现被拒的局面。
  • 驱动程序升级:这一支持将集成到 AMDGPU 开源驱动程序中,取代现有的 HDMI 2.0 支持,以满足更高带宽需求。
  • 社区反应热烈:Hacker News 社区对此表示欢迎,认为 HDMI Forum 长期以来是科技行业的“肿瘤”和“寄生虫”,此次突破被视为对开源社区的重大胜利。

意义与影响

1. 打破标准垄断,推动开源生态 HDMI Forum 长期以来因其封闭的授权模式和较高的专利费用被业界诟病。AMD 和 Valve 的成功合作表明,开源社区有能力通过技术积累和商业谈判打破标准制定者的壁垒。这将激励其他厂商(如 Intel 和 NVIDIA)跟进,推动整个 Linux 图形生态向更开放、更先进的显示标准迈进。

2. 提升 Linux 游戏与桌面体验 对于 Linux 用户,尤其是游戏玩家而言,完整的 HDMI 2.1 支持意味着可以在 Linux 上获得与 Windows 同等的顶级显示体验。高刷新率(120Hz+)和高分辨率(4K/5K)的支持将显著提升游戏流畅度和桌面视觉效果,缩小 Linux 与 Windows 在高端显示技术上的差距。

3. 促进硬件接口多元化 尽管 HDMI 在电视和消费电子产品中占据主导地位,但 DisplayPort (DP) 在显示器领域往往提供更优的性能和更低的延迟。此次突破可能促使更多设备制造商重新评估接口策略,甚至推动 DisplayPort 在电视和主机领域的普及,从而减少对 HDMI 标准的过度依赖。

4. 为 HDR 和其他高级功能铺路 评论中提到的“下一步是 HDR 支持”表明,HDMI 2.1 的开源实现只是第一步。随着底层驱动程序的完善,Linux 上的高动态范围(HDR)显示、可变刷新率(VRR)等高级功能也将得到更好的原生支持,进一步提升用户体验。

查看原文 →techpowerup.com